package storage import ( "os" "path/filepath" "testing" ) func TestFileStorageListDirectoriesSymlink(t *testing.T) { storageBaseDir := t.TempDir() subdirName := "sub" slFileName := "sl" symlinkTargetDir := t.TempDir() if err := os.MkdirAll(filepath.Join(storageBaseDir, subdirName), 0700); err != nil { t.Fatalf("failed to construct subdir: %s", err) } if err := os.Symlink(symlinkTargetDir, filepath.Join(storageBaseDir, subdirName, slFileName)); err != nil { t.Fatalf("failed to create symlink at '%s' which points to '%s': %s", filepath.Join(storageBaseDir, subdirName, slFileName), symlinkTargetDir, err) } store := FileStorage{baseDir: storageBaseDir} dirs, err := store.ListDirectories(subdirName) if err != nil { t.Fatalf("failed to list directories: %s", err) } if len(dirs) != 1 { t.Fatalf("dirs should have 1 entry") } dir := dirs[0] // This condition is important -- the returned path should be relative to // the storage base dir, not the symlink's target dir. if dir.Name != filepath.Join(subdirName, slFileName) { t.Errorf("Expected dir.Name to be '%s' but it was '%s'", filepath.Join(subdirName, slFileName), dir.Name) } }
